If there is one garment that defines Kushboo’s fashion legacy, it is the saree. She is widely credited with making the "Kanchipuram Silk" look a household aspiration. Her style gallery is a vibrant collection of: Rich pattu sarees with heavy gold borders.
Before the bodycon era, Kushboo mastered the 80s Western-inspired Indian wear. High-waisted skirts paired with puff-sleeved blouses and a thin dupatta were her go-to for dance numbers like “Kaadhal Vaithu” (from Nattukku Oru Nallavan ).
